Abstract
Problems concerning the occurrence and development of dangerous endogenous processes in southern regions of Russia are considered. Based on analysis of primary data from the seismological network, the Q-factor of the layered geophysical medium and the attenuation of the elastic wave energy are estimated. The newly obtained data argue for the hypothesis about a possible domain of manifestation of fluid-magmatic processes in the Elbrus volcanic area.
